''Two Sunny Winters In California'' is a travelogue written by Gulielma Crosfield and published in 1904. The book chronicles the author’s experiences during her two winters spent in California, where she traveled with her husband and two children. Crosfield writes about the stunning natural beauty of the state, including the Sierra Nevada mountains and Yosemite Valley. She also describes the many interesting people she met, such as artists, writers, and scientists, and the cultural and social events she attended.
